WebFeb 14, 2024 · When treating a person with PTSD, it may be productive to assess family and social support at the beginning of and throughout treatment. Even for people only pursuing individual therapy, improving relationships may be a goal of treatment, in which case repeated assessment will help tailor treatment focus. WebAug 8, 2024 · Yes, PCT is a therapy supported by research. The evidence for this therapy is not as strong as research supporting trauma-focused psychotherapies, like Cognitive Processing Therapy (CPT), Prolonged Exposure (PE) or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R).
